Commercial OfficerSF33798Location: Devonport, PlymouthAbout the RoleWe are looking for a dynamic, ambitious and competent Commercial Officer to join our high performing team.This is a role within the Mission Systems business stream in the Defence Systems Technology (DST) business unit. The successful applicant will be a part of both the Information Systems and Critical Communications departments, offering an excellent opportunity to work on a wide array of projects. The role is based primarily in Devonport with necessity for offsite travel to customer meetings as required. You will also have the opportunity to work from home.Responsibilities

  • Lead as a Commercial department representative with regard to contractual and commercial issues for both internal project teams and external customers
  • Support the identification and development of opportunities for new business growth and take ownership of agreeing contracts
  • Implement tendering/contracting policies and procedures in support of the submission of Prime Contract tenders, tasking forms, and Contract Amendments to secure profitable and cash generative contracts
  • Prepare contracts and commercial elements of tender submissions, including reviewing Invitations to Tender, recommending bid/no-bid management approval, undertaking commercial evaluation against corporate contracting policies and presenting commercial and tender review documentation up to Group level
  • Review and negotiate Prime Contracts and Subcontracts within financial levels of authority
  • Negotiate and resolve claims and disputes both for and against the Company, within financial levels of authority
  • Monitor Prime Contract performance against contractual obligations, arrange contract close-out meetings and be responsible for resolving all outstanding issues/claims
  • Manage, support and develop department staff including graduates
  • Advise Project Managers/Business Unit Leads with regard to commercial issues
  • Act as a Trade Control Officer (TCO), responsible for providing export/import advice across the department and ensuring compliance with trade legislation and regulations
  • Qualifications and Experience
  • Education to degree standard, preferably in Business or Law
  • IACCM, MCIPS or an equivalent qualification preferable
  • The ability to analyse terms and conditions and write appropriate qualifications within limits of authority
  • You could be someone coming from a legal background looking to move into a Commercial Officer role, or someone with commercial experience managing contracts and tendering
  • Experience within the defence industry desirable
